A small gathering. A long night.

Vigil unfolds in the quiet intensity of a wake...a room suspended between memory and departure. As friends and family gather, what surfaces isn’t just grief, but the complicated terrain of love, regret, humour, and the strange rituals we perform around loss.

Saunders brings his signature blend of compassion and sharp observation, but this feels more restrained than some of his earlier, more overtly satirical work. There is tenderness here, a sense of unease.

The dialogue hums but it's about what is said...and what isn’t.

About the strange clarity that can arrive in the dark.

For readers who loved the emotional intimacy of Lincoln in the Bardo but want something less busy, more grounded.
